This Sunday, we will begin a study of Philippians. I encourage you to read through even listen to this Epistle. If you want to take a step back read Acts 16, it will help give a little history.

You can listen through the app Youversion or even go online to Bible gateway.

Questions to consider as you read:

1) What is the main topic of the epistle?
2)What verses stand out to you and why do they stand out?
3) Consider how Paul and the Philippians encouraged and supported each other. How can we as a church, a small group and a local body of Christ encourage and support each
other?

The book of Ruth is a short but powerful story in the Old Testament that highlights the importance of loyalty, faith, and love. The book is set during the time of the judges in Israel and tells the story of Ruth, a Moabite woman who marries into an Israelite family and becomes an ancestor of King David.
